Wine Staging 11.0 Release Candidate 1 released

The first release candidate for Wine Staging 11.0 is here. This release candidate is more than just a random assortment of changes; consider it a meticulously crafted compilation of features and fixes, thoroughly tested by the winehq.org team.

Wine Staging's main gig is basically acting as a testing ground, like an early preview area separate from the regular development work. It lets users jump right in and try new things as soon as they appear, offering fresh perspectives to help developers catch issues before the official launch.

This latest build sits right on top of Wine 11.0-rc1, with vkd3d-latest updated, a key part that's been honed through user testing and developer tweaks.
